  • The microsporogenesis,megasporogenesis,the development of male gametophyte,female gametophyte,embryo and endosperm,and double fertilization of Conyza canadensis(L.) Cronq were studied in this paper.The results show as follows:the anther is tetrasporangiate and its mature wall comprises of an epidermis,endothelium,a middle layer and a single-layered tapetum;the epidermis degenerates;cells of endothelium persisted are columnar and with fibrous thick walls;the middle layer degenerates early and only a vestige can be observed at meiosis-I of microsporocyte;the tapetum belongs to glandular type,generally,is out of shape and degenerates early at meiosis-I of microporocyte;cytokinesis in the microsporocyte meiosis is of the simultaneous type,and the microspore tetrads are tetrahedral or isobilateral;pollen grains are mainly 3-celled,and occasionally 2-celled;the ovary is bicarpellate,unilocular,one ovules and basal placenta;the ovule is unitegmic,tenuinucellate,anatropous and with developed endothelium;archesporial cell of megaspore differentiates immediately below the nucellar epidermis and functions as megasporocyte after development,and then,the megasporocyte undergoes meitotic to form a linear tetrad,only one chalazal megaspore in linear tetrad becomes the functional megaspore;the embryo sac is of the Polygonum Type;two polar nuclei melt into a secondary nuclei before fertilization;fertilization is porogamous;the development type of the endosperm is Nuclear Type,and the embryogeny belongs to the Asterad Type;endosperm haustorium is present.
